The following weapons were used in the film Oscar (1991):
Colt Detective Special
A Colt Detective Special is used in the film .
Colt Police Positive
Several police officers appear to be armed with the Colt Police Positive revolver.
Colt New Service
Connie (Chazz Palminteri) is seen pulling out a Colt New Service and pointing it at Anthony Rossano (Vincent Spano). This revolver is later taken away by Angelo "Snaps" Provolone (Sylvester Stallone).
Smith & Wesson Model M&P
What appears to be a Smith & Wesson Model M&P is seen in the hands of Officer Quinn (Art LeFleur).
M1928 Thompson
The M1928 Thompson submachine gun is seen carried by gangsters.
